WebCinnamaldehyde is not miscible with water because it is a largely non-polar molecule. The ring and majority of the hydrocarbon chain in this molecule are nonpolar, while only the aldehyde is polar. Water is a highly polar solvent and so it will dissolve solute molecules that are also polar. The large nonpolar region of cinnamaldehyde means it ... WebCharacterization of pure cinnamaldehyde Chemical detection Cinnamaldehyde was detected according to Tollen’s test (Cheronis & Entrikin, 1963). Cinnamaldehyde (30 mg) was added to a test tube containing 2 mL of Tollen’s reagent. The tube was then placed in a water bath set at 35°C for 5 min. A silver mirror resulted around the test
